IN PROFILE: DOWNTON ABBEY’S LILY JAMES CHANNELS 60S VIBES

Last Christmas, Lily James won audiences over with her portrayal of Lady Rose, the hellraising grand-niece of Maggie Smith’s Downton Abbey dowager. In an exclusive video and shoot for Wonderland, she takes off the blonde curls and shows us her best a sixties siren instead.

Tipped by some to be the “next big thing in British acting”, James has come a long way since playing Billie Piper’s flatmate in Secret Diary of a Callgirl. Here, she tells us she’ll always be Team Maggie.

Where did you grow up? I lived in Surrey my whole life until I went to drama school and have lived in various parts of Hackney ever since.

Last lie you told? I don’t usually lie, I can’t lie, but I’ve had to tell a few big lies recently! But I can’t say…

Biggest guilty pleasure? I don’t really watch that much TV, so I guess it would be chicken and chips after a night out.

Period drama or sci-fi epic? Period drama.

Maggie Smith or Shirley McClaine? Has to be Maggie Smith.

Dream dinner date? Getting properly dressed up and going somewhere fancy is fun as I’m usually so casual.

Best comfort food? Marmite on toast.

Weirdest childhood memory? When we were on a family holiday when I was younger and the pool was so freezing cold that I spent my time dancing around it instead, attracting a steadily bigger crowd…

What’s a typical day on the Downton Abbey set like? Early call time, blonde wig which takes forever to put on, three outfit changes of beautiful vintage 1920s dresses, a lot of sitting around drinking tea and eating biscuits with a bit of acting sandwiched in.

Yourself in three words. Instinctive, extreme, friendly.
